The International Business and Languages program at NHL University of Applied Sciences is a comprehensive and dynamic degree designed to prepare students for successful careers in the global marketplace. This program combines in-depth business education with advanced language skills, enabling graduates to operate effectively in multicultural and international environments. Students will gain a solid foundation in core business disciplines such as management, marketing, finance, and entrepreneurship, while simultaneously developing proficiency in multiple languages, including English and other relevant European languages. The curriculum emphasizes practical learning through case studies, internships, and project-based assignments, ensuring students acquire real-world experience that aligns with current industry demands.

Throughout the program, students will explore the cultural, economic, and legal aspects of international trade and business operations. They will learn how to communicate effectively across borders, negotiate with international partners, and develop strategic plans for multinational companies. The program also offers specializations in areas such as international marketing, intercultural management, and global supply chain management, allowing students to tailor their education to specific career interests. Language courses are integrated throughout the program, with opportunities for immersion and exchange programs abroad, fostering linguistic competence and cultural awareness.

Graduates of the International Business and Languages program will be well-equipped to pursue careers in international trade companies, multinational corporations, diplomatic services, translation and interpretation, or start their own international ventures. The program’s emphasis on bilingualism, intercultural competence, and practical business skills makes it an ideal choice for students aiming to thrive in a competitive global environment. With a focus on innovation, leadership, and global perspectives, this program prepares students to become proactive and adaptable professionals capable of making meaningful contributions in the international arena.
